What drives Alpharetta premiums
Alpharetta is metro Atlanta's premium north-side market
Alpharetta is metro Atlanta's premium north-side market — Zillow puts the typical home near $656,000 — and it sits in the part of the metro that takes the most spring hail. That combination is exactly where policy structure matters more than premium: a percentage wind/hail deductible on a $650,000 dwelling limit is thousands of dollars of out-of-pocket that two same-priced policies can treat completely differently.
The housing stock skews newer and larger than the metro average
The housing stock skews newer and larger than the metro average — swim-tennis subdivisions from the 1990s onward, plus the newer urban core around Avalon and downtown. Newer construction earns modern-code credits, but those 1990s-era roofs are now at exactly the age where carriers shift from replacement cost to actual-cash-value roof settlements. Knowing which side of that line your policy sits on is worth more than any discount.

Tech-corridor growth keeps rebuild costs climbing, which quietly raises both dwelling limits and premiums at renewal. The response that works is the one that works everywhere in Georgia, only with more dollars at stake: document the roof, convert the deductibles to dollars, and re-shop the identical coverage across carriers rather than negotiating with one.
Local weather risk
North Fulton sits in the hail-prone northern arc of metro Atlanta, where spring supercells tracking the foothills drop the metro's largest stones. Severe thunderstorm wind, tornadoes on the occasional strong system, and heavy tree canopy over established subdivisions round out the loss picture; winter ice appears every few years. Most common claim drivers: spring hail — the north metro's dominant claim driver, severe thunderstorm wind and occasional tornadoes, falling trees and limbs from mature subdivision canopy, occasional winter ice storms.

What a standard policy typically covers
Most homeowners policies are written against a named list of causes of loss. These are the ones that show up on a standard form — grouped the way an adjuster thinks about them, so you can see where your risk actually sits.
